Langston Cove Phase III


Overview
Langston Cove is a residential development consisting of 25 two-flats in Chicago’s historic Auburn-Gresham neighborhood.  The buildings feature three distinct styles of brick facades and a range of upgrades, including garages.  Construction will begin its third phase this Spring with delivery in Fall 2007.

Langston Cove is another addition to the area, which has seen new development for some time now.  Other developments include SOS Children’s Village and Park Village, with 40 new homes at 76th and Parnell just a few blocks away. The Langston Cove two flats are part the City of Chicago’s New Homes for Chicago program so all buyers must qualify.  These award winning homes were designed by the architectural firm Smith & Smith Associates, Inc. also located in Chicago.

This current phase consist of 14 homes located on two sites.  The first is at the corner of 77th and Green Street, across from the Oglesby School.  The second is on the 7900 block of South Parnell Avenue.  Each two-flat has a duplex owner’s unit plus a ground-floor two-bedroom rental unit. The rental unit was designated to meet ADA accessibility standards.

Duplex three-bedroom owner’s unit 1500 square feet
Ground-floor two-bedroom rental unit 750 square feet
Total area, two-flat building 2250 square feet
